Melbourne Instruments has announced availability of advanced Logic Pro integration for its motorized software and hardware MIDI controller. Expanding upon its successful integration with Ableton Live and Bitwig Studio, integration with Apple’s popular professional DAW for Mac is now available for the Roto-Control.
Advanced Logic Pro integration for Roto-Control has arrived, expanding on our recent implementation of Ableton Live and Bitwig Studio support.
Roto-Control introduces a fully tactile, motorized controller for Logic Pro users, delivering fast, hands-on control of tracks, plugins, smart controls and automation. MIX Mode mirrors Logic Pro’s session track names, colours and order, while providing high-resolution control of volume, pan, sends, and instant access to mute, solo, record-arm and track focus.
PLUGIN Mode allows users to browse and select Logic Pro instruments and effects directly from Roto-Control. Parameters can be mapped instantly using touch-and-learn, with up to eight pages of controls stored on the device ready for any project. Smart Controls are automatically mapped, offering up to 16 parameters available in both PLUGIN Mode and the dedicated SMART Mode.
Roto-Control is available to purchase for $399 USD (excl. tax) in the USA and Canada, $619 AUD (incl. GST) in Australia, €372.35 EUR (excl. VAT) in EU, $469 USD in Japan/Asia, and £389 GBP in the UK.
The new (3.0.1) firmware update for Roto-Control with Logic Pro integration is downloadable for free.
